Non-Surgical Rhinoplasty for Mild Nose Irregularities
Non-surgical rhinoplasty for mild nose irregularities is a cosmetic approach that focuses on improving the appearance of the nose without involving surgical procedures. It is often chosen by individuals who want subtle refinements rather than dramatic structural changes. This method typically works by carefully adjusting the surface appearance of the nose to create better symmetry and smoother contours. The overall goal is to enhance facial balance while keeping the natural character of the nose intact. Many people appreciate this approach because it offers noticeable improvements without long recovery expectations associated with traditional surgery.
How It Helps Improve Mild Nose Irregularities
Mild nose irregularities can include small bumps, slight asymmetry, or uneven contours that affect facial harmony. Non-Surgical Rhinoplasty in Dubai addresses these concerns by focusing on visual alignment rather than altering bone or cartilage. It is especially suitable for individuals who feel that minor adjustments could make their facial features appear more balanced.
This approach is often considered when the irregularities are not severe but still noticeable enough to affect confidence. It helps refine the nose shape in a way that blends naturally with other facial features, creating a smoother and more harmonious appearance.
The key improvements usually focus on:
- Smoothing small surface bumps
- Enhancing symmetry between both sides of the nose
- Improving the bridge line for a straighter appearance
- Refining the nasal contour for better facial proportion
- Creating a more defined yet natural-looking shape
